06-24-2008
Thanks for the reply......I have tried by giving the command...............
awk 'NR==FNR{a[$1]=$2;next}{print $1, a[$1]}' File1 File2
or
nawk 'NR==FNR{a[$1]=$2;next}{print $1, a[$1]}' File1 File2
But Iam getting the output as
Id Name
1-43<<1 space>>Swapna
1-3456<<1 space>>Kapil
But I need output as
Id Name
1-43<<1 space>>Swapna
1-234
1-3456<<1 space>>Kapil
10 More Discussions You Might Find Interesting
1. Shell Programming and Scripting
Is there a command that sets a variable length?
I have a input of a variable length field but my output for that field needs to be set to 32 char.
Is there such a command?
I am on a sun box running ksh
Thanks (2 Replies)
Discussion started by: r1500
2 Replies
2. Shell Programming and Scripting
Hi, I have two input files.
File1:
ID Name Place
1-234~name1~Newyork
1-34~name2~Boston
1-2345~name3~Hungary
File1 is a variable length file where each column is seperated by delimitter "~".
File2:
ID Country
1-34<<11 SPACES>>USA<<7 spaces>>
1-234<<10 SPACES>>UK<<8... (5 Replies)
Discussion started by: manneni prakash
5 Replies
3. UNIX for Dummies Questions & Answers
Hi, all.
I need to convert a file tab delimited/variable length file in AIX to a fixed lenght file delimited by spaces. This is the input file:
10200002<tab>US$ COM<tab>16/12/2008<tab>2,3775<tab>2,3783
19300978<tab>EURO<tab>16/12/2008<tab>3,28523<tab>3,28657
And this is the expected... (2 Replies)
Discussion started by: Everton_Silveir
2 Replies
4. Shell Programming and Scripting
Hi everyone,
I have been working on a pretty laborious shellscript (with bash) the last couple weeks that parses my firewall policies (from a Juniper) for me and creates a nifty little columned output. It does so using awk on a line by line basis to pull out the appropriate pieces of each... (4 Replies)
Discussion started by: cixelsyd
4 Replies
5. Shell Programming and Scripting
Hi,
Can anyone help with a effective solution ?
I need to change a variable length text field (between 1 - 18 characters) to a fixed length text of 18 characters with the unused portion, at the end, filled with spaces.
The text field is actually field 10 of a .csv file however I could cut... (7 Replies)
Discussion started by: dc18
7 Replies
6. Shell Programming and Scripting
I am trying to selectively display several columns from a db2 query, which gives me a fixed-width output (partial output listed here):
--------- -------------------------- ------------ ------
000 0000000000198012 702 29
000 0000000000198013 ... (9 Replies)
Discussion started by: ahsh79
9 Replies
7. Shell Programming and Scripting
Hi All ,
I have a requirement where I need to remove duplicates from a fixed width file which has multiple key columns .Also , need to capture the duplicate records into another file .
File has 8 columns.
Key columns are col1 and col2.
Col1 has the length of 8 col 2 has the length of 3.
... (5 Replies)
Discussion started by: saj
5 Replies
8. UNIX for Dummies Questions & Answers
How do I extract values in a few columns in a row of a fixed length file?
If there are 8 columns and I need to extract values of 2nd,4th and 6 th columns, how do i do that? I used cut command, this I used only for one column. How do I do it more than one column?
The below command will give... (1 Reply)
Discussion started by: princetd001
1 Replies
9. UNIX for Dummies Questions & Answers
I have a fixed width file of length 53. when is try to get the lengh of the record of that file i get 2 different answers.
awk '{print length;exit}' <File_name>
The above code gives me length 50.
wc -L <File_name>
The above code gives me length 53.
Please clarify on... (2 Replies)
Discussion started by: Amrutha24
2 Replies
10. Shell Programming and Scripting
Hi Team,
I have an issue to split the file which is having special chracter(German Char) using awk command.
I have a different length records in a file. I am separating the files based on the length using awk command.
The command is working fine if the record is not having any... (7 Replies)
Discussion started by: Anthuvan
7 Replies
LEARN ABOUT DEBIAN
kdiff3
KDIFF3(1) General Commands Manual KDIFF3(1)
NAME
KDiff3 -- compares two or three input files or directories
SYNOPSIS
KDiff3 [QT options] [KDE options] [KDiff3 options] [File1/base] [File2] [File3]
DESCRIPTION
This manual page documents briefly the KDiff3 tool.
This manual page was written for the Debian distribution because the original program does not have a manual page. For comprehensive help,
please see khelpcenter help:/kdiff3.
KDiff3 is a program that
o compares or merges two or three text input files or directories
o shows the differences line by line and character by character
o provides an automatic merge-facility and
o an integrated editor for comfortable solving of merge-conflicts
o supports Unicode, UTF-8 and other codecs
o supports KIO on KDE (allows accessing ftp, sftp, fish, smb etc.)
o Printing of differences
o Manual alignment of lines
o Automatic merging of version control history ($Log$)
OPTIONS
This program follows the usual GNU command line syntax, with long options starting with two dashes (`-'). A summary of options is included
below. For a full summary of options, run KDiff3 --help.
-m, --merge
Merge the input.
-b, --base file
Explicit base file. For compatibility with certain tools.
-o, --output file
Output file. Implies -m. E.g.: -o newfile.txt
--out file
Output file, again. (For compatibility with certain tools.)
--auto No GUI if all conflicts are auto-solvable. (Needs -o file)
--qall Don't solve conflicts automatically. (For compatibility...)
-L1 alias
Visible name replacement for first file/base file.
-L2 alias
Visible name replacement for second file.
-L3 alias
Visible name replacement for third file.
-L, --fname alias
Visible name replacement. May by supplied for each input.
--cs string
Change a setting, e. g. --cs "AutoAdvance=1".
--confighelp
Show a list of all settings and their values.
--config file
Use a different settings file.
--author
Show author of program.
-v, --version
Show version of program.
--license
Show license of program.
AUTHOR
This manual page was written by Eike Sauer <eike@debian.org> for the Debian system (but may be used by others). Permission is granted to
copy, distribute and/or modify this document under the terms of the GNU General Public License, Version 2 (or, at your option, any later
version published by the Free Software Foundation).
On Debian systems, the complete text of the GNU General Public License can be found in /usr/share/common-licenses/GPL.
KDIFF3(1)